How much is the rebate for solar panels in Walmer, NSW

The Australian Federal Government has incentives for Walmer homeowners to install solar. They give "STCs" (small-scale technology certificates) to people who add a solar power system to their home.

The government divides the country into "Zones" depending on the rated solar potential. You get more support or less depending on your zone. Walmer is in Climate Zone 3 which has a rating of 1.382.

This means a 10 kW solar system installed in Walmer during 2024 would give you 96 ST Certificates worth $3830.40 (at an STC price of $39.90 each).

If you wait until 2025 for your panels the rebate in Walmer will be reduced. It goes down every year.

Here's about how much Solar Energy falls on Walmer by month. The maximum is 7.44 kWh/M2 in December. The minimum is 2.56 kWh/M2 during June.

Daily Energy Per Square Metre in Walmer
MonthEnergy MJ/M2kWh/M2
Jan26.737.43
Feb23.476.52
Mar19.885.52
Apr15.334.26
May11.513.20
Jun9.212.56
Jul10.172.82
Aug13.353.71
Sep17.764.93
Oct21.996.11
Nov24.546.82
Dec26.807.44

Figures from the weather station at Wellington, which is approximately 17.1 km from Walmer.

Walmer, NSW is in the 2820 postcode area which has around 821 solar installations under 10 kW and about 909 total installations including large scale solar. In comparison there are about 105107 small solar installations in the Gold Coast region.

With an estimated 3070 households in the 2820 area that gives a small solar installation (average size around 4.16 kW) for about every 3.7 dwellings.

Solar Panel Angle in Walmer

It is generally recommended to angle your panels at about 32.7° from the horizontal in this area - facing north, although your power usage patterns could alter this - if you are out all day.
